https://callback.58.com/antibot/verifycode?serialId=22c9511ad08ec9e253207510aaf38976_0c7d2b416a5b4fcb955e8f21089b287b&code=100&sign=eb3e5d578a78abcbd6158a40f8e590fd&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fchongqing.anjuke.com%2Fsale%2Ffengduxian%2Fa15862-b118-d47-l10-m17033-o2-t12-y3-z782513-fl2-xf1